Standard Match - Just a normal 3 count match. No rules apply.
Note: It is 4 count in Mexico - it is much more difficult to an pin opponent this way

Street Fight - No Disqualification match. Person who gets pinfall or submission wins. (Just as no disqualification match)

1st Blood - First person that bleeds loses.

2 out of 3 Falls - First person to score 2 pin falls or submissions wins.

Fatal Four Way (Four Corners) - First person to score the first pin or submission wins.

Ambulance Match - Throw your opponent into the back of an ambulance then close the door wins.

Bar Room Brawl - Hardcore match that starts in a Bar.

Barbed Wire Cage Match - Cage wrapped in barbed wire.

Barbed Wire Rope Match - Ropes are replaced with barbed wire.

Over the Top Battle Royal - Last person in the ring after eliminating everyone over the top rope. There can be a tag team Battle Royal. The wrestlers either enter the ring in certain periods of time (WWF Royal Rumble) or start in one or two rings at the same time (WCW World War 3)

Blood Bath Match - Loser passes out due to loss of blood.

Boiler Room Brawl - No rules, first person to get out of the broiler room wins.

Buried Alive - First person to bury their opponent in the provided hole wins. (Just as graveyard match)

Cage Match - This match takes place inside a 15' steel cage with an open top. There are two types of cage matches. The traditional cage match is won by being the first wrestler to escape the cage and have both feet touch the floor. The other variation is basically a One fall match inside a cage.

Car Trunk Match - Throw your opponent into a car trunk and close it wins

Casket Match - First person to be put in a casket and have the top closed loses

Chain Match (Variations: Strap, Collar Match) - A match that ends when a wrestler touches all four turnbuckles a row. Before the match opponents are strapped with collars that the chain is attached to.

Death Match - Some Sort Of Mix Of Standard And Last Man Standing Matches. After The Pin, The Wrestler Has To Stand Down For 10 Seconds To Win

Dumpster Match - First person to lock their opponent in a dumpster wins

Flaming Dumpster Match - Throw opponent into the dumpster and set it on fire wins

Elimination Match - Team Or Multiple Wrestler Match. The Rules Differ Depending On A Match. In Multiple Wrestler Match The Person That Gets Pinned Leaves The Ring; The Others Continue To Wrestle. In A Multiple Team Match The Team Which Member Is Pinned Leaves The Ring. The Exclusion Is Two Team Match, For Example, WWF's Infamous Survivor Series (4-on-4) - Wrestlers Are Eliminated One By One.

Flag Match - First person that gets their flag wins

Flaming Casket Match - Put opponent in casket then light it on fire to win

Flaming Hell in a Cell - A Cell That's On Fire Flaming Table - Put your opponent through a flaming table to win

Glass Table - Put your opponent through a table that's covered in glass

Handcuff Match - Handcuff opponent to win

Hell On Top Of A Cell - Fight on top of a cell, if you fall you have 10 seconds to get on the cell

I Quit Match - Make Your Opponent Say "I Quit" To Win

Inferno Match - Fire surrounding the fire, first person to be set on fire loses

Intergender Tag Match - A Standard Tag Team Match, But One Member OF Each Team Is Definitely A Woman

Iron Man Match - A Specified Time (Usually, An Hour) Match. The Wrestler, Who Pins His Opponent Most Times Wins

Ladder Match - Wrestler has to climb to the top and get the belt or money to win

Last Man Standing Match - Match Goes Until One person Stands Down For A 10 count

Lumberjack Match - A Standard Match With People Who Surround The Ring. The Wrestler, Who Falls Over The Top Gets Beating From Them

No Holds Barred - No rules

Something On a Pole Match - There is a pole on one of the corner turnbuckles, with some object hanging on it. The first person to get that thing, wins the match.

Submission Match - Win by submission only

Table Match - Put opponent through a table to win

Tag Team Match - A match in which two teams of wrestlers face each other. Only one wrestler from each team is allowed in the ring at a time. The others wait on the apron outside the ropes. Interference from a team member will not end the match in a disqualification. That wrestler will be escorted back to his/her corner.

Tag Team Cage - This match takes place inside a 15' steel cage with an open top. There are two types of cage matches. The traditional cage match is won by being both team members to escape the cage and have both feet touch the floor. The other variation is basically a One fall match inside a cage.

Tag Team Ladder - First person that climbs then ladder and gets the belt or money wins match for his team

TLC - Tables, Ladders, Chairs match - Hardcore 3 Tag Teams Match, first person to get the belt hanging above the ring wins

TLCC- Tables, Ladders, Chairs, Canes match. Hardcore 3 Tag Teams Match, first person to get the belt above the ring wins

Triple Threat Turmoil - Multiple wrestler (Tag Team) match. But there can not be more than two wrestlers (teams) in the ring at a time. They enter the ring one by one, until they are eliminated. matches

War Games - Cage tag match. The wrestlers enter one by one in certain periods of time
